Orienteering
Orienteering is an activity for all ages and levels of fitness and skill, in which the object is to locate control points within the park using a detailed map. It can be enjoyed as a leisurely walk in the woods or as a competitive sport combining the suspense and excitement of a treasure hunt.

Sat Aug. 20
Running Wild: 5k trail run & 3k fun walk A FUNd-raising run and walk to benefit St. Joseph County Parks! Help us raise funds for park projects, including scholarships to help schools cover the cost of transportation to the parks for programs. Dogs on leashes are welcome for the fun walk, which includes a wacky nature-themed scavenger hunt. There will be age division prizes for timed runs. There will be no day of registration. -
Thu Sep. 1
Bag a Bat and eat a Batnana Split Meet Wildlife Biologist Jeremy Sheets as he talks about the various species of bats found in Indiana and shows how bat information is collected for research. Registration and payment required by August 30. -
